Profile bio

About Lars Frøyd

I am an expert on global analysis of offshore dynamic and floating structures, i.e: floating and bottom fixed wind turbines, O&G platforms and FPSO's, and their moorings and risers/cables. My main strength is combination of strong theoretical/analytical/digital skills with experience on stakeholder/interface- and project management, and practical experience from marine operations and offshore work. I have experience from Operator side, Engineering Contractor side, and Installation Contractor side. My experience in design and analysis of offshore dynamic systems include: Global dynamic analysis of floater motions, mooring lines, flexible risers and power cables, floating wind turbines. Design of permanent mooring systems. Design of dynamic riser/cable systems with ancillaries. Subsea layout and riser routing, on-bottom stability. My experience in marine operations and installation include: Heavy lifting, wind turbine installation, permanent mooring chains, dynamic and static riser/cable installation, vertical lay systems, J-tube pull-in, subsea end tie-in and in-place analyses, etc. I am familiar with procedure and spec writing, HAZOP’s, HAZID’s and Risk Assessments, and familiar with relevant NORSOK, DNV and API standards.

Hywind Scotland Marine Operations Engineer

Oslo

I was responsible for all technical aspects and daily follow-up of the heavy lift mating contract and associated interfaces. This was a first-of-its-kind operation where 5 wind turbines were lifted and mated onto floating foundations, with extreme requirements on weather limitations and tolerances. In addition to follow up the lifting contractor and their analyses and documentation, I lead the internal analysis team. I entered late in the project when mating procedure and analyses were at draft level, but I discovered severe shortcomings in the analysis work and had to force through late design and procedural changes (which likely avoided a catastrophic failure during the lifting of the first turbine). I also discovered that the mating site wind characteristics were uncertain and that this could cause several days of waiting on weather (at huge cost). I took the initiative to a LIDAR wind measurement campaign starting just weeks before the operation, but this was sufficient for necessary improvements and confidence in the local weather forecasts. In the weeks leading up to, and during, offshore campaign I functioned as the de facto project manager and coordinator for vessel representatives, in addition to coordinating as-built last-minute analyses, and contractors for dimensional survey, wind measurements and forecasts. While offshore, I noticed that lack of inter-contract communication was leading to non-optimal schedule and potential for several days of lost time. On my own initiative I liaised with the Project Director and started coordinating the scheduling resources directly and we were able to save at least 4 days of waiting time with the worlds largest heavy lift vessel Saipem 7000. The engagement was a project based secondment from 4Subsea.

Project Engineer

Emas Amc

Oslo Area, Norway

Responsible for subsea layout related to installation of 2 out of 3 new subsea manifold structures at Njord installed summer 2013. Due to congested seabed and unexpectedly difficult soil conditions no solution for the center manifold had been found and it was planned delayed to 2014 when I started. I had no experience in this field but got proficient quickly and was able to find a solution to the center manifold location with a novel way of using subsea installation aids. All manifolds were installed summer 2013, leading to huge savings for the client Statoil. Work included routing, installation and tie-in of several risers and jumpers, all the way from conceptual work, analyses, lay-table generation, and procedure writing, to going offshore as project engineer during installation of the first manifold. The engagement was a project based secondment from 4Subsea.
